Top 5 Maps and Navigation Apps in Tunisia Q4 2025

In Q4 2025, the top Maps and Navigation apps in Tunisia showed varied performance metrics across downloads, revenue, and active users, according to Sensor Tower data.

Navionics® Boating by Garmin saw a fluctuating revenue pattern, peaking at $129 in mid-November. Weekly downloads started at 204 in early October, declining to 44 by the end of December. Active users decreased steadily from 552 to 303.

Gaia GPS: Offline Trail Maps experienced a notable revenue spike to $34 in late October. Downloads increased significantly in early November, reaching 75, while active users rose to 81 around the same time, before gradually declining.

TomTom GO Expert: Truck GPS saw modest revenue, with a high of $20 in late October. Downloads remained low, peaking at 16 in mid-December, while active users maintained a steady presence around 25 throughout the quarter.

The Compass app - Accurate Compass showed a brief revenue increase to $30 in early November. Downloads increased from 48 in early October to 89 by mid-December, with active users peaking at 89 in December.

A Better Routeplanner (ABRP) had consistent low revenue, with a brief increase to $22 in late November. Downloads were minimal, and active user numbers slightly increased to 12 in early December.
